Subject: Quickstore 4.2 — bloom filter now fronts the KV layer

Plugin authors: starting with this release, Quickstore places a bloom filter ahead of the key-value store. Negative lookups return faster; false positives fall through safely. No API changes are required on your side. Verify your plugin against the staging build referenced below.

session token of fahif-tadup = htk3_9c7

**Sorting stability in Gridwright reports**

Heads up, future maintainers: the Gridwright report builder relies on stable sorts everywhere. Users stack sorts (region, then revenue), and if the underlying sort isn't stable, secondary ordering silently scrambles. We swapped in a stable merge sort back in v4 — don't "optimize" it away. The regression tests and design rationale are written up here.

wiki page, tahaf-tajog: https://jira.ordindyn.corp/pipeline

Leadership Review Briefing — Board

Recommendation: close the Dunmere satellite office of Carrowfield Logistics by quarter end. Headcount of six transfers to the Pellbrook hub; two roles eliminated. Lease break penalty is modest and offsets within seven months. Client coverage unaffected. Closure communications drafted and ready. The confidential note on downstream plans is set out below.

internal memo for yahag-hahig: Belwynix Group plans to lower the Silir list price by 62 percent in May.